6. Property Prices and Disaster (In)Justice: Fifty Years of Demographic Change in Hawai’i County’s Lava Hazard Zones
University essay from Lunds universitet/Avdelningen för Riskhantering och SamhällssäkerhetAbstract : While there is a degree of homogeneity in the physical impact that volcanic hazards can cause, the experience of volcanic risk and the politics of exposure are far from equal. The purpose of this thesis is to expand on research citing population growth and property price dynamics as factors encouraging settlement in the Mauna Loa and Kīlauea lava hazard zones. READ MORE

9. The impact of covid-19 on income inequality in Sweden : Empirical evidence using municipality data
University essay from Linnéuniversitetet/Institutionen för nationalekonomi och statistik (NS)Abstract : This study uses data between 2011 and 2020 from the 290 municipalities of Sweden to investigate theeffect that covid-19 has had on income inequality. Excess mortality rate is used as the variablemeasuring the intensity of the pandemic and the Gini coefficient as well as percentile quotas representsincome inequality. READ MORE
